You try re-seating everything? IE: Turn off the system, unplug the main power, turn off the PS. Then open the case and re-seat all the cards, memory - check the CPU fan/heatsink/cooler, etc. and all the connections. Then plug it all back in and power up. Once in a while - if a connector or something isn't seated properly it will eventually come loose.

Okay! Well the system is supposed to have the dual bios and it's supposed to work automatically. Can you get into the BIOS setup? Hit the del key as soon as you power it on. Maybe you'll be lucky enough to get into the BIOS before the failure but maybe not. If you can get into the BIOS check the date and time; if you know your system you might check other settings but it can get tricky because if you change something it may harm your system. I wouldn't save anything! If the date/time are fine I would exit and see if it will boot up; if they're not then check to see if you can change the CMOS battery. If everything looks fine you should be able to boot up - hopefully that dual bios setup will kick in and you'll be good but that all depends upon if you can get into the BIOS in the first place. One thing I do when a system gets like that is to hit CTRL+ALT+DEL in the bios to 'reboot' - generally it won't save anything and will just restart.
